When a host is moved to a new acces VLAN, i.e. from VLAN 1 to VLAN 200 with different IP subnets, the IP address returned when a router is supplied still reports the the hosts old VLAN 1 IP address when a scan is run again. I checked the router for the mac address and it shows in both VLANs as the old entry has not aged out yet. Perhaps when retrieveing the IP the lowest aged entry is used as the IP address to return?
